I have a Flex based SWF being loaded with FBML into my facebook application. When the application is initially loaded and the SWF is served up, a rails session is created. At that request, I have a full facebooker session object and everything is fine.<br>
<br>However, on any subsequent *flex* requests back to our API (using httpservice), it doesn't maintain that initial session setup when the application first loaded. It creates a new session, and the fb_sig parameters are no where to be found. <br>
<br>If I do a full browser refresh of the page though, it goes back and uses that initial session that was created when the app first loaded. It would appear that the browser is working with rails correctly to maintain the session, but since Flex doesn't send http calls through the browser that way, it gets a new session any time it makes a call by itself. <br>
<br>Any ideas on how to go about making the Flex app be able to talk back to the rails app and use the same initial session that was created upon loading the app?<br>
